What we offer:Job Responsibilities:
Supplier Quality & Development
· Communicate key project expectations and quality requirements to suppliers and internal teams.
· Develop, monitor, and maintain supplier micro plans to drive targeted improvements.
· Develop suppliers to AIAG and OEM-specific standards to ensure consistent delivery of high-quality products.
· Utilize expert knowledge to help suppliers correct systemic or process-related deficiencies.
· Manage and track supplier corrective actions to closure.
Assessments & Performance Monitoring
· Conduct on-site supplier assessments as required to evaluate quality systems, processes, and compliance.
· Prepare written reports documenting assessment results, deficiencies, and required actions.
· Follow up on supplier responses and ensure timely completion of commitments.
· Track supplier incoming quality performance using established quality operating system metrics.
· Develop, manage, and support all supplier rating system deliverables, including continuous improvement initiatives.
Supplier Engagement & Improvement
· Schedule and lead Supplier Systemic Improvement Meetings (SSIM) with suppliers exhibiting performance concerns.
· Support APQP and Warranty functions as required to resolve supplier-related issues.
· Ensure effective communication and alignment with suppliers on quality expectations, standards, and improvement activities.
Standards, Compliance & Safety
· Adhere to MAFACT, IATF 16949, and OEM customer-specific requirements.
· Comply with ISO 14001 Environmental Standards and all company Health & Safety systems.
· Maintain excellent housekeeping and always promote a culture of safety.
Additional Responsibilities
· Perform additional duties as assigned to support departmental and organizational objectives.
Supplier Quality Performance
· Supplier Parts Per Million (PPM): Achieves and maintains targeted reductions in supplier defect rates through proactive development and corrective action engagement.
· Supplier Quality Performance: Ensures suppliers consistently meet quality, delivery, and compliance expectations based on established performance scorecards.
· Effectiveness of Supplier Systemic Corrective Actions: Drives timely, thorough, and sustainable corrective actions with measurable long-term improvements.
Protocol Lead Responsibilities (if applicable)
· Key Characteristic Audits: Performs audits on specific key characteristics as defined by the Quality Manager, ensuring compliance and process capability.
· Supplier Capability Analysis: Reviews, tracks, and analyzes on-site capability data, identifying trends and leading suppliers toward long-term improvements.
· Corrective Action & Strategy Follow-Up: Ensures prompt closure of corrective actions and implementation of long-term strategic solutions for chronic issues.
Reporting & Data Management
· Timely Reporting to Supplier Quality Manager: Provides ongoing updates on findings, risks, improvement opportunities, and recommendations.
· Data Tracking & Organization: Maintains accurate, organized records of supplier performance, assessments, capabilities, and improvement activity.
· MRB/DMN/QPF Management: Ensures timely follow-up and closure of Material Review Board actions, Deviation Management Notices, and Quality Problem Forms.
· Monthly Statistical Reporting: Prepares and presents monthly reports detailing supplier quality results, capability metrics, trends, and improvement plans.
